Abstract
A developed, binary, image-processing technique is proposed, and a dua l-channel, optical, real-time morphological processor is developed. Ni ne binary image processings can be realized fully in parallel. The mea sures for compensating scale and rotation distortion for pattern recog nition are provided. Some applications of optical, morphological binar y image processing are studied and experimental results are listed. (C ) 1997 Optical Society of America.
